Atlantic City, where Donald Trump and Steve Wynn were once fierce rivals before they were friends, is heating up in more ways than one as summer approaches.

Now, an Atlantic City penthouse that once belonged to casino mogul Wynn has listed for $2.19 million. What’s more, it has expanded in size to become a massive 7,500-square-foot duplex.

The residence is on Atlantic City’s iconic boardwalk, overlooking the Atlantic Ocean. When Wynn owned the aerie back in the city’s heyday, he hosted glamorous parties. Guests included legends like Frank Sinatra, who performed at Wynn’s neighboring Golden Nugget Hotel & Casino during the 1980s.
